Hammond" <[email protected]> wrote: > Hi All, > > Not sure around the world, but lately in the US FO-29 and AO-51 have been experiencing a mutual footprint from time to time. Since the AO-51 145.920 uplink is within the passband of FO-29's transponder, you can often hear AO-51 uplinks coming through FO-29 as an FM signal on the downlink... > > Anyhow, it's about to occur in about 30 mins, thought I'd mention it... > > 73, > > > > > Mark L.
